From: David Woodhouse Date: Sat, 28 Oct 2023 19:34:53 +0000 (+0100) Subject: KVM: selftests: add -MP to CFLAGS X-Git-Tag: v6.7-rc6-pxa1908~75^2~1 X-Git-Url: https://git.dujemihanovic.xyz/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=96f124015f825a4a186b8497e20cf87f6519c7b4;p=linux.git KVM: selftests: add -MP to CFLAGS Using -MD without -MP causes build failures when a header file is deleted or moved. With -MP, the compiler will emit phony targets for the header files it lists as dependencies, and the Makefiles won't refuse to attempt to rebuild a C unit which no longer includes the deleted header.
